  • Get ready for Red Hot Chili Peppers in Europe!

    Today the following shows were announced in France:

    June 6th at Halle Tony Garnier in Lyon
    June 8th and 9th at Bercy in Paris

    Confirmed tour dates will be announced on a territory by territory basis, starting with the following schedule:

    February 13th - UK shows will be announced
    February 16th - Spain shows will be announced
    February 18th - German shows will be announced
    March 1st - Czech shows will be announced

    Stay tuned as more shows will be announced as they are confirmed!

  • UK dates have just been anounced, they are:

    June 30, Ipswich, Portman Road
    July 2, Coventry, Ricoh Arena
    July 3, Reading, Madjeski Stadium
    July 5, Derby, Pride Park
    July 6 , Sheffield, Don Valley
    July 11 and 12 at Manchester, Evening News Arena
    July 14, 15, 17 and 18, London, Earls Court Arena

    Tickets go on general sale on Feb 17th.
